Analysis of Fault Tolerance in Hypercube
Abstract
Multiprocessor systems which afford a high degree of parallelism are used in variety of applications. The extremely stringent reliability requirement has made the provision of fault-tolerance an important aspect in the design of such systems. This paper presents a new technique called wormhole technique to route the message for multiprocessor systems. It emphasizes the concept of fault tolerance in n-dimensional hypercube. Worn hole switching technique is considered for forwarding the data from source to destination, faulty nodes are detected and the path of transfer of packets from source to destination is rerouted.
Keywords: Fault tolerance, wormhole switching, hyper cube, shortest path algorithm
